This book introduces educational practitioners students and scholars to the people concepts questions and concerns that make up the field of critical social theory. It guides readers into a lively conversation about how education can and does contribute to reinforcing or challenging relations of domination in the modern era. Written by a group of experienced educators and scholars in an engaging style Critical Social Theories and Education introduces and explains the preeminent thinkers and traditions in critical social theory and discusses the primary strands of educational research and thought that have been informed and influenced by them.
